BigRentz CEO gives advice on preparing the Rental Market for the future

The CEO of BigRentz, Scott Cannon, was chosen as a key panelist at the American Rental Association (ARA) Show 2019 to discuss the role of technology in shaping the future of the rental industry over the next 10 years, and how it can make companies more efficient and profitable. The technology panel included moderator Wayne Walley, editor at Rental Management, and executives from other technology companies.

ARA is an international non-profit trade association for the equipment rental business and has members in 30 countries worldwide. The week-long event is attended by more than 7,000 people, and this year took place at Anaheim Convention Center from February 15-21st.

BigRentz is the nation’s largest online construction equipment rental network and Cannon shared with the audience the importance of data and analytics in driving better processes, including decisions like the pricing of rentals, unitization forecasting, and real-time access to available inventory.

He commented, “It was a great privilege to be part of a panel of specialists at such a prestigious show. I enjoyed sharing my insights on technology and hearing the questions and challenges people in the industry face. I truly believe that more updated processes and automated online rentals provide a better customer experience, more revenue and higher customer retention.”

He added, “Full adoption of technology within the industry still has a long way to go, but 10 years from now the rental industry will be primarily driven by data analytics.”

The ARA expects equipment rental revenue to reach $56 billion next year. The association serves not only the construction industry, but also industrial, party, event and wedding rentals.
